The Hindu-Muslim “unity rally” scheduled to be held on Monday in Jauli village, one of the riots affected areas in Muzaffarnagar, was cancelled after severe opposition from the local BJP leadership and Hindutva groups. Citing law and order issues, the district administration withdrew the permission to organise the rally at Jauli canal, about 15 km from Muzaffarnagar.
